FAQ
A removable blockage may only need cleaning. Broken, separated, collapsed, or heavily deteriorated pipe may need repair. Diagnosis is necessary before choosing the solution.
Common contributors include age, corrosion, shifting soil, root intrusion, joint failure, and physical damage.
It should be evaluated promptly, especially when wastewater enters the property or multiple fixtures are affected.
